Variable pricing is as old as parking meters


From Gizmodo, a celebration of the parking meter's 75th birthday (as calculated from the date of Carl Magee's patent application). Read it, it's nicely cranky.

Note that in the first installation, in Oklahoma City:

Your five cents (about $.80 in today's money) got you anywhere from 15 minutes' to an hour's worth of parking, depending on location.

That's right, variable pricing.
